About this Event

Traditional Alsatian Decorations Workshop (10:30AM - 12 PM)

Families can enjoy a hands-on craft atelier featuring holiday decorations inspired by Alsatian traditions. Special treats, music, and festive surprises will make the day memorable for all!

L'Heure du Conte with Chloé ! (12:00 - 12:30 PM)

From 12:00pm to 12:30pm, we invite parents and children (recommended age 3-6 years old) to gather in the children's room of our library for Benoit's story time in French! It will feature a selection of magical stories.

Free Crochet Workshop (2:00–3:00 PM)

Join us for a cozy crochet session with the crochet team of the Brookline Teen Center! Recommended for ages 9 and up, learn the basics and craft a mini beret for your favorite plush buddy in perfect Parisian style.

Enter our raffle!

Remember to enter our FREE raffle for a chance to win a fabulous gift for you or your loved ones.

Enjoy a French-themed market!

We'll have a line-up of fantastic vendors throughout the day: Beautiful Amore Skincare, Black Leaf Tea & Culture, Bouquet de France, Cadeau Boutique , Del’s Coffee Roasters , Fresh Cut Yarn, Gourmet Delights by Sonia,  Louis Sel, Nouvelle Maison, Maré Fleur,Photographies by Félicie Petit Nivard, Candles by Clémentine,  Boutique de Soie, Heavenly Spirits, Provence Wine and more! Don't miss out on this opportunity to shop for French treats, libations, and gifts!
